Hi everyone.

I'm doing a study that will use ABAQUS to analyze the 3D printing process.

I would like to ask, does this use event series?

Because I found a script to convert GCODE to event series.

If so, is it necessary to write the inp file and put the event series into it?

Is there a faster way to create an inp file for the 3D printing process?

I don't know how to apply the data generated by the script to abaqus.

The name of the script is generateEventSeries.py

Thanks for your help!!

New versions of Abaqus include a built-in plug-in called AM Modeler that lets you define such analysis without having to add the keywords manually. You just need the event series files.
